Transaction 08d1a9635b0b843657e8e9dc1d9d750e5160c9f75c28d863b4d8b298dd073c20
1 Input
1 Output
-
08d1a9635b0b843657e8e9dc1d9d750e5160c9f75c28d863b4d8b298dd073c20:0
- value
- 19706584
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58d159cd68427373d319c029a147ddbfaad26bc9 OP_EQUAL
- address
- 39neBNaEGYsnsQh3ULgQDWFk3v5eKSt8oS